unfinished CR kit
About 6 months ago I purchased a Cobra kit car without knowing who manufactured it. looking at pictures on the club site I am pretty sure it is a Classic Roadster. I do not know the age but it is important to substantiate its manufacturer as I intend on going the SB100 path as a 1965. I purchased the body and a home made chassis which I was told followed factory specs, kind of a poor job, am not sure if I will fix this one or build a new one. The most identifying differences with this car are the door opening which goes almost to the floor and the totally integrated fender wells, floor and trunk, of course the 92 inch wheel base. I have never even sat in a Cobra except when a friend let me drive his around the block, that was in 1968.
The build manual would be invaluable as I have purchased several books which are all helpful but not specific to this car.
I have done several ground up restorations, but this one will be a family driver, the others turned out to be too valuable, my son is deep into the cars and we enjoy working together on the projects.
Thank you and I hope I have described the car so that you think I have a CR.
